1. Understanding Coil Springs and Their Importance

Coil springs play a critical role in your Mazda's suspension system, supporting weight and absorbing shocks. Influencers like Jason Lewis, an automotive engineer and frequent contributor to Car and Driver, emphasize the importance of keeping them in good condition to ensure safety and performance.

Coil Spring Functions

Function Description
Load Support Holds the weight of the vehicle, providing a stable base.
Shock Absorption Absorbs road bumps for a smoother ride.
Alignment Maintenance Keeps tires properly aligned for better handling.

2. Regular Inspection of Coil Springs

Regularly inspecting your coil springs can help you catch wear and tear before it becomes a significant issue. Experts like Jessica Hall, a popular automotive YouTuber known for her CX-Series review videos, recommend checking for rust, sagging, and cracks at least twice a year.

3. Cleaning Your Coil Springs

Keeping your coil springs clean not only improves their appearance but also prolongs their lifespan. Simple cleaning involves removing debris and washing with soapy water. Influencer Ben Chan, known for his DIY car care guides, suggests using a soft brush to reach spots that may collect dirt.

5. Avoid Overloading Your Vehicle

Overloading your Mazda can put additional stress on the coil springs, leading to premature failure. Vehicles should not exceed their maximum load capacity, as advised by automotive professionals. Influencer Mike Dawson emphasizes understanding your vehicle's limits, especially if you frequently carry heavy loads.

6. Shocks and Struts Maintenance

Remember, coil springs work in conjunction with shocks and struts. Like automotive influencer Rachel Adams, a mechanical engineer, states, maintaining these components is crucial since worn shocks can lead to uneven wear on coil springs.

7. Consider Professional Installation for Upgrades

If you decide to upgrade your coil springs, consider seeking professional installation. This ensures that they are installed correctly, maximizing performance and safety.
